I am working as an election judge this week at the Montclair Rec. Center. I have been there or the past week accepting absentee ballots.
Thee are a handful of factors that are causing us to expect the Montclair site to be VERY busy on Sat. Oct 28th (today). This could mean some longish lines on this one day.
To avoid waiting in lines, voters may want to consider one of the other locations instead. Or waiting to vote one day during the week. (hours are 10am – 8 pm)
In addition to having been told by a couple hundred voters in the past week they are planning on coming to vote today at Montclair, there is also a volleyball tournament going on at the rec. center which will likely have at least several dozen more potential voters, and dozens of fewer parking spaces.
I have requested (and gotten!) additional voting machines at the Montclair location to accommodate the crowd better.
